n 47 N Using Your VAIO Computer Copying Files to CDs To determine which type of CD your computer supports, see Reading and Writing CDs and DVDs (page 44). To copy files to a CD-RW or CD-R ! Do not strike or shake the computer while writing data onto a disc. 1 Insert a blank CD-R or CD-RW disc into the optical disc drive. If the CD Drive window appears, click Take no action. 2 Open Windows Explorer by pressing the Windows key and the E key simultaneously. 3 In the Folders panel on the left, locate the file(s) or folder(s) you want to copy and either: ❑ Right-click the file(s) or folder(s), point to Send To, and click the optical disc drive* name. ❑ Drag the file(s) or folder(s) onto the optical disc drive icon in the Files Stored on This Computer panel. 4 Close Windows Explorer. 5 Click Start and then My Computer. 6 Click the optical disc drive icon under Devices with Removable Storage. A new window appears with the file(s) or folder(s) you want to copy listed under Files Ready to Be Written to the CD. 7 In the CD Writing Tasks box, click Write these files to CD. 8 Follow the instructions in the CD Writing Wizard. * The read/write drive letter designation may vary, depending on your system's hardware configuration.
